question about sins
« on: Wednesday 02 August 2006, 04:54 »
wassalam my brothers and sisters :-D

I hope you are in best state of health..inshAllah..

i have a trouble concerning the sins

I have friends that are non Muslims, and some of them are Muslims but they dotn pray for exapmle when I do..( in this case at school)

i want to apprach them about Islam, but I dont know how and I am not sure if they are going to listen ...

is this a sin if we dont appraoach them>>?? one of the friends is nonMuslim, and I want to talk to her about it, but there has been a war between my country and hers, and the attackers on Bosnia ( my country) were against Muslims.


so is this a sin if we dont warn them about the only true pathway abou Islam, ?
I have a wish to do this, but I am afraid... :|

 :oops: :| :| :'( :'( :'( :'(


and you know this situation when you get emails from Islamic things,u send them to Muslims only, ut not those who are not? Is that a sin???

I know we are only suppose to fear Allah, but this is a hard task, as I am fearing what will thay say, and are they going to be friends with me later..coz one of them is close to me..

what should I do??????? :oops:

Try in your most humblest way to approach your friends and open the subject slowly with them. If you find that they are not getting angry then keep going, bit by bit, eventually saying all that you feel a duty to say, keeping in mind that you should be kind and patient and humble.

in shaa' Allaah they will listen to you and if they don't then you did what you can.

Of course if they are true friends they will take your advice as something precious.

mā shā'a-llāh, may Allāh reward ur intentions. 'āmīn

it is a duty upon us to tell people what is right and wrong, but we cant do much sometimes.  when u go to pray, just tell ur friends, "u guys coming to pray?", maybe later they will feel guilty for not praying. show them what islām is by ur manners and ur character, i also have non muslim people around me and some of my friends dont pray also. but u can only do very little. make du^ā that Allāh softens their heart like He has softened mine and urs. 'in shā'a-llāh, nothing happens without His will.  u dont randomly speak about islām to them, the way u act will show them what islām is.  bring the topics up slowly, if need be, but dont always say "islām says this and that" because this will drive them away from u, and we dont want that, may Allāh grant u the ability to benefit them. 'āmīn

only u know how much ur trying with ur friends, so the least faith requires is for u to hate the action in ur heart. and may Allāh reward u for it. 'āmīn
